Computing in Memory Bibliography

With processor clock rates outstripping memory access times, and each new hierarchy of caching contributing more overhead, it makes sense to put some of the processing internal to the memory where there already exists thousands of times more bandwidth then at the CPU.

Here's my bibliography of multiple processors in memory. The PIM and C-RAM were specifically designed to be useful as main memory. I've made the sometimes subjective distinction between "multiple processors integrated into structure of memory array" and "multiple processors and memory macros integrated onto a chip".

Multiple processors integrated into structure of memory array


Pixel Planes

Multiple processors and memory macros integrated onto a chip


Geometric Array Parallel Processor

Single processor and significant memory integrated onto a chip

Analog Devices SHARC
Designs without hardware implementations

